Ogun Police to conduct Officers Shooting Range Exercise on Tuesday 16th Dec, advise the public to exercise caution

The Ogun State Police Command has announced a shooting range exercise for its officers, scheduled to take place on Tuesday, December 16, 2025.

The training is part of ongoing efforts to strengthen operational readiness and enhance law enforcement efficiency across the state.

In a press statement e-signed and release to the National Association of Online Security News Publishers, NAOSNP by the Command’s new Public Relations Officer, DSP Oluseyi B. Babaseyi stated that, “The Ogun State Police Command wishes to inform the general public that a Shooting Range Exercise for its officers will take place on Tuesday, 16th December 2025 at the 35 Artillery Brigade of the Nigerian Army, Alamala, Abeokuta, Ogun State. This exercise is part of the Command’s training program to enhance operational readiness and marksmanship skills.”

According to the statement, “Residents, commuters, and members of the public in and around the exercise area are advised to exercise caution and avoid the marked vicinity during the exercise. The Command assures everyone that strict safety measures have been put in place and the expected gunfire sounds should not cause alarm.

The Ogun State Police Command seeks the cooperation and understanding of all residents as this important training is conducted. Following safety instructions will help ensure the smooth conduct of the exercise while keeping everyone safe.
